Palletizing is the critical bridge connecting manufacturing packaging lines with warehouse storage and distribution transport. Manual pallet stacking is slow, physically punishing, ergonomically hazardous, and prone to unstable pallet builds that collapse during transit. Complete End-of-Line Palletizing System Modules
A complete Autorise Empowers turnkey palletizing installation integrates multiple specialized automation sub-systems:- Articulated Robotic Palletizers: High-speed 4-axis and 6-axis articulated robot arms operating with linear velocities up to 2.5 m/s and payload capacities from 50 kg to 500 kg with ±1.0mm repeatability.
- Overhead Cartesian Gantry Palletizers: Heavy-duty structural gantry systems with X-spans up to 30 meters and payload capacities up to 1,000+ kg for simultaneous multi-line palletizing.
- Custom End-of-Arm Tooling (EOAT): Vacuum foam matrices for cartons, heavy mechanical side-clamps for valve bags, bottom-support fork tooling for shrink-wrapped packs, and magnetic arrays for steel pails and drums.
- Automatic Empty Pallet Dispensers & Magazines: Vertical stacking magazines holding 15 to 20 empty wooden or plastic pallets, automatically dispensing single pallets onto infeed roller conveyors on demand.
- Automatic Slip-Sheet & Top-Cap Applicators: Vacuum arm applicators that pick cardboard or plastic slip-sheets from a magazine and place them between product layers or atop finished pallets for moisture protection.
- Integrated Stretch Wrapping & Strapping Systems: In-line rotary arm or turntable stretch wrappers with automatic film cutting and clamping, paired with vertical/horizontal strapping heads.
- Automatic Pallet Barcode Labeling & Verification: Real-time print-and-apply automated corner label applicators integrated with barcode scanners that apply GS1 shipping labels and verify readability before AS/RS entry.
Comprehensive Engineering Lifecycle Methodology
- Packaging Geometry & Stacking Pattern Simulation: Analyzing product dimensions, carton crush strengths, bag bulge characteristics, and pallet overhang rules. Utilizing 3D pattern generation software to design interlocking stacking recipes that maximize pallet stability and cubic container density.
- Structural Chassis & Tooling Fabrication: Precision machining of lightweight aerospace aluminum and carbon steel gripper plates, structural safety fencing, infeed conveyor staging beds, and heavy pallet conveyor transfer beds.
- Control Architecture & PLC Programming: Engineering master control panels utilizing Siemens S7-1500 or Allen-Bradley ControlLogix PLCs with intuitive 12" touchscreen HMIs for rapid recipe selection and real-time cell diagnostics.
- Category 4 / PL e Safety System Integration: Integrating safety perimeter guarding, muting light curtains on pallet exit corridors, safety interlock door switches, and emergency stop circuits compliant with ISO 10218-1/2.
- Factory Acceptance Testing (FAT) & Load Validation: Conducting full-speed trial runs with customer products at our manufacturing plant to verify pick reliability, layer squareness, and cycle speeds prior to shipment.
- On-Site Installation, Commissioning & Operator Training: Mechanical anchoring, electrical tie-ins, line sensor tuning, live production ramp-up, and certified operator training.

Preventative Maintenance, Gripper Care & Lifecycle Support
Our palletizing workcells are engineered for 24/7 continuous industrial duty. Preventative maintenance procedures include monthly vacuum filter cartridge cleaning and foam pad wear inspections, quarterly checks of robot joint harmonic gearbox grease levels, and semi-annual safety validation of light curtain muting sensors and interlocked access doors compliant with ISO 13849-1. Comprehensive Stacking Recipe Simulation & Box Interlocking Algorithms
Our palletisation engineering team utilizes proprietary 3D stacking pattern software to generate optimized pallet layer recipes for hundreds of distinct SKU dimensions. The algorithms calculate carton compressive strength, center-of-gravity distribution, and interlocking tier geometries to eliminate pallet leaning and prevent transit damage. Plant operators can select new recipes in seconds via the touchscreen HMI without requiring manual robot reprogramming.
